cifs монтируют оператор от сбоев сценария удара, и только возвращает предложения использования

Фон: у Меня есть рабочая ubuntu Mate пи двух малины, и у меня есть сценарий удара, который выполняет команду монтирования на обоих.

Малина Pi1 хорошо работает, но когда я скопировал по файлам для pi2, я не могу соединиться по некоторым причинам.

мой сценарий удара похож на это...

#!/bin/bash
# Mount Shared Folder on Jay's computer
jip=$(php /var/www/html/Update-Project-Files/utilities/get_jay_ip_for_pi2.php)
echo $jip
mount -t cifs -o username=username,password=pass,uid=33 '//'$jip/work_video_files /var/www/html/Update-Project-Files/Mounts/Jay_mount

Это называет php файл для получения IP для компьютера совместно используемой папки и затем называет монтирование. Я ничего не изменил, потому что это хорошо работает на моей первой машине, но по некоторым причинам это не будет работать на 2-ю машину.

если я пробую команду от командной строки и sub в IP, я могу смонтировать, что папка успешно, но запускающий этот скрипт от командной строки только распечатает IP от эха (как ожидалось), и затем использование для монтирования отображено.. Я предполагаю сообщение мне, моя команда монтирования является неправильной?

таким образом вывод похож:

pi2@pi2:~$ sudo /bin/bash /var/www/html/Update-Project-Files/scripts/mount_shared_folder_for_pi2.sh 2>&1

xxx.xxx.xxx.xx

Использование: смонтируйтесь [-lhV] монтируют, что-a [опции] монтируют [опции] [-источник] | [-цель] монтируется [опции] монтируются []

Смонтируйте файловую систему.

Опции:-a, - все монтируют, что все файловые системы, упомянутые в fstab-c, - нет - канонизируют, не канонизируют пути-f, - поддельный пробный прогон; пропустите монтирование (2) syscall-F, - ветвление ветвления прочь для каждого устройства (использование с-a)-T, - fstab альтернативный файл к/etc/fstab-i, - внутренний единственный не называет монтирование. помощники-l, - выставочные маркировки показывают, что также файловая система маркирует-n, - нет не пишут в/etc/mtab-o, - разделенный запятыми список опций опций монтирования-O, - тест - выбирает, ограничивают набор файловых систем (использование с-a)-r, - монтированием только для чтения файловая система, только для чтения (то же как-o ro)-t, - типы ограничивают набор типов файловой системы - источник явно указывает источник (путь, маркировка, uuid) - цель явно указывает, что точка монтирования-v, - подробный говорят, что делается-w, - rw, - чтение-запись монтирует чтение-запись файловой системы (значение по умолчанию)

- h, - справка отображают эту справку и выходят из-V, - информация о версии вывода версии и выход

Источник:-L, - синоним маркировки для МАРКИРОВКИ =-U, - uuid синоним для UUID = МАРКИРОВКА = указывает, что устройство файловой системой маркирует UUID =, указывает устройство файловой системой UUID, PARTLABEL = указывает, что устройство разделом маркирует PARTUUID =, указывает устройство разделом, UUID указывает, что устройство точкой монтирования пути для связывает, монтируется (см. - bind/rbind), регулярный файл для установки loopdev

Операции:-B, - связывают, монтируют поддерево где-то в другом месте (то же, поскольку-o связывают)-M, - перемещение перемещает поддерево в некоторое другое место-R, - rbind монтируют поддерево, и все подмонтируется где-то в другом месте - делают - совместно использованная метка поддерево столь же общий - метка делать-ведомого-устройства поддерево, как ведомое устройство - делает - частная метка, поддерево, столь же частное - делает - несвязываемая метка, поддерево, столь же несвязываемое - делает-rshared рекурсивно метку, целое поддерево, столь же общее - делает-rslave рекурсивно метку целым поддеревом, как ведомое устройство - делает-rprivate рекурсивно метку, целое поддерево, столь же частное - делает-runbindable рекурсивно метку целым поддеревом как несвязываемый

Какие-либо мысли, на почему или что дальнейшие шаги я мог взять для точного определения проблемы?

После дальнейших взглядов... Я полагаю, что это вызвано тем, что pi1 имеет запись для монтирования в fstab, но pi2 не делает. Я должен буду проверить завтра, когда я доберусь до той машины. Я не знал, что монтируется, обязательно нуждался в записи в fstab. Я думал, что fstab запустил скрипты при запуске, но от чтения этого...

https://help.ubuntu.com/community/Fstab

Я чувствую, что не понял fstab прежде. Это звучит выполнимым?

Заключительное Обновление.... Я так и не смог получить эту работу, и загружаться имело проблемы соединения Ethernet, таким образом, я просто фрагментировал ее. Я фокусируюсь в другом месте теперь. Я плохо знаком с Linux, но узнаю, что столько ошибок, кажется, лежит в основе проблем полномочий, возможно, монтирующаяся ошибка выше была тем же.

0
задан 28 March 2017 в 07:37

0 ответов

Другие вопросы по тегам:

Похожие вопросы: